5 reasons why small businesses should make the switch to the cloud:


Save Money

Using cloud-based software can save you money on purchasing different software packages, installing them, and ensuring the updates are completed and compatible with your computer and other software. This can be a never-ending loop that costs you money (and time!). Cloud software providers take care of updates and maintenance which is included in the monthly subscription costs.

Save Time

If you have previously spent a lot of time manually inputting data such as invoices, bank reconciliation, and reporting, we have good news for you! By switching to cloud software, these things (and more) are all automated, saving you time and allowing you to spend your time growing your business. Some of your old bookkeeping work happens while you sleep!

Collaborate

You can access your data online from any device – smartphone, tablet, PC, or Mac – which allows for easy collaboration among your team. You can quickly share documents and data through the cloud rather than waiting for co-workers back at the office to find a file and email it to you.

Using the cloud has additional benefits for your MB+M accountant and adviser. Access to real-time data provides us with an up-to-date picture of the profitability and cash flow of your business which allows us to give you the best advice.

Security

Did you know that cloud-based software is safer than on-premises software? This is because there is no physical item to steal or be lost in a disaster. If someone were to steal your computer or laptop, they cannot access your data due to strong encryption and password protection, similar to internet banking. Another win!

Environment

By using the cloud, you no longer need to use paper, ink, or hard drives for your accounting needs. If your cloud needs fluctuate, the server where your data is stored scales the capacity up or down depending on your needs. You only use the energy you require and do not leave an extensive carbon footprint. It’s a win-win for the environment and your business!
